The Market for African Performing Arts (MASA) has announced a list of the artists to take part in this year’s event in Abidjan, Côte d’Ivoire, from 7 to 10 March.
This after MASA received 187 applications from musicians in African countries including South Africa, Mali, Gabon, Tunisia, Ivory Coast and Tanzania. There were also applications from countries such as Canada, Switzerland, Germany and Colombia.
74 groups were selected to take part, with 13 of them coming from the host country. The groups were selected according to categories: music (48 groups), dance (7), theatre (10), Storytelling (4), stand-up comedy, street arts (2) and slam (1).
The 25th anniversary of MASA coincides with the 10th edition of the event, which began in 1993.
